A man has been charged after firearms, property and cannabis plants were seized in a national park in the state’s north.

Officers from New England Police District received information relating to thefts in the Ebor, Dorrigo, and Bellingen areas committed by people camped in the Cathedral Rock National Park, near Ebor.
Police attended the location at Ebor and recovered an ATV, a loaded .22 calibre pump action rifle, assorted ammunition, a knuckle duster, fridges, generators, cash, various power and non-power tools, trail cams, smashed National Park collection boxes and assorted other items.
The total value of these items has been estimated at over $50,000.
A cannabis site was also located with 193 cannabis plants seized from a netted and fenced area.
A 30-year-old man was arrested at the location and taken to Armidale Police Station.
He was interviewed and charged with unauthorised possession of firearm, unauthorised possession of ammunition, and possessing a prohibited weapon.
He was granted conditional bail to appear at Armidale Local Court on Tuesday, January 29.
New England Police District are seeking information from the public to assist in identifying owners of the recovered property.
